(81 posts)This is just one of several. Some others:
- We also can't deduct SaLT anymore (which is a big deal in some blue states). This seems like straight up political hit to me against Democrats in California, New Jersey, and New York. State income taxes are how we pay for education, public defenders, infrastructure, etc.
- Assuming Trump finds his way into a second term somehow, his likely Democrat predecessor will face immense pressure to extend the tax cuts in their very first year since they expire in 2025. This will ultimately define that year for whoever is president at the time.
